   > Thanks @hgeraldino!
   > 
   > I'm a little confused by the amount of churn here--it seems like a lot of 
utility methods related to topic creation, record transformation, etc. have 
been removed and their contents inlined directly into test cases. If this isn't 
necessary for the migration, can we try to retain that approach in order to 
reduce duplication?
   > 
   > It's also worth noting that there are unused stubbings in some of these 
tests, which should be failing the build but are not at the moment due to 
[KAFKA-14682](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/KAFKA-14682). You can find 
these unused stubbings by running `./gradlew :connect:runtime:test --tests 
AbstractWorkerSourceTaskTest` in your command line, or possibly by running the 
entire `AbstractWorkerSourceTaskTest` test suite in IntelliJ (which is how I 
discovered them). These unused stubbings should be removed before we merge the 
PR.
   
   That's fair. Personally I prefer self-contained test methods hat can be read 
top-bottom (without having to jump around), even if it violates the DRY 
principle. But I'm ok on keeping the existing structure & style, so I put back 
the (revised) helper methods
